Prosecutions Lawyer - West Yorkshire

£42,650 - £46,780 | Exceptional career opportunity with extensive training and development for those interested in a career in Prosecutions.

About the Role
  1. Following an initial training period, you will spend 60-80% of your time in court prosecuting a wide range of offences, utilizing your skills to achieve desired outcomes. The remaining time will be dedicated to case preparation.
  2. The role offers a combination of induction training, bespoke modules, mentoring, and on-the-job coaching, making a career as a Prosecutions Lawyer accessible to lawyers considering a change in direction.
  3. Basic requirements include a genuine interest in criminal prosecutions and qualification as a Solicitor or Barrister in England and Wales. Experience in contentious law is preferable but not essential; applicants from all disciplines with a desire to learn are encouraged to apply.
  4. Strong decision-making skills and exceptional written and verbal communication skills are essential.
